What are the requirements for GMP?

Good Manufacturing Practice (GMP) requirements are essential guidelines that ensure the quality and safety of products, particularly in the pharmaceutical, food, and cosmetic industries. These regulations are designed to minimize risks involved in production that cannot be eliminated through testing the final product. GMP covers all aspects of production, from raw materials to hygiene of staff. Here’s a comprehensive look at GMP requirements and their significance.

What is Good Manufacturing Practice (GMP)?

Good Manufacturing Practice (GMP) is a system that ensures products are consistently produced and controlled according to quality standards. It is designed to minimize the risks involved in any pharmaceutical production that cannot be eliminated through testing the final product. GMP regulations require a quality approach to manufacturing, enabling companies to minimize or eliminate instances of contamination, mix-ups, and errors.

Key Requirements of GMP

1. Quality Management

A robust quality management system is the foundation of GMP. This includes:

  • Documented procedures: Clear, detailed procedures must be documented and followed.
  • Quality control: Regular testing of products to ensure they meet required standards.
  • Continuous improvement: Ongoing efforts to improve processes and product quality.

2. Personnel

Personnel involved in manufacturing must be adequately trained and qualified. This involves:

  • Training programs: Regular training sessions to keep staff informed of GMP standards.
  • Hygiene protocols: Strict personal hygiene practices to prevent contamination.
  • Qualified staff: Ensuring all personnel have the necessary skills and qualifications.

3. Premises and Equipment

The manufacturing environment must be suitable for production. Key considerations include:

  • Cleanliness and maintenance: Regular cleaning and maintenance of facilities and equipment.
  • Proper design: Facilities must be designed to minimize contamination risks.
  • Equipment calibration: Regular calibration and validation of equipment to ensure accuracy.

4. Raw Materials

The quality of raw materials directly impacts the final product. Requirements include:

  • Supplier quality assurance: Selecting reliable suppliers with consistent quality.
  • Testing and validation: Regular testing of raw materials for quality and safety.
  • Proper storage: Ensuring raw materials are stored in conditions that maintain their quality.

5. Production

Production processes must be clearly defined and controlled. This involves:

  • Standard Operating Procedures (SOPs): Detailed instructions for manufacturing processes.
  • Batch records: Comprehensive records for each batch produced, ensuring traceability.
  • In-process controls: Regular checks during production to ensure consistency and quality.

6. Quality Control

Quality control is essential for ensuring the final product meets the required standards. This includes:

  • Final product testing: Comprehensive testing of the finished product for quality and safety.
  • Stability testing: Assessing the product’s shelf life and stability under various conditions.
  • Release procedures: Only releasing products that meet all quality criteria.

What industries require GMP compliance?

GMP compliance is required in industries where product safety and quality are critical, including pharmaceuticals, food and beverages, cosmetics, and medical devices.

How does GMP differ from ISO standards?

While both GMP and ISO standards focus on quality management, GMP is more specific to industries like pharmaceuticals and food, emphasizing product safety and hygiene. ISO standards are broader and apply to various sectors, focusing on overall quality management systems.

What are the consequences of non-compliance with GMP?

Non-compliance with GMP can lead to severe consequences, including product recalls, legal action, damage to brand reputation, and loss of consumer trust.
